Understanding the Problem
Micro-management from a non-technical stakeholder often stems from a place of anxiety – a desire to ensure success and a lack of understanding of the technical complexities involved. They may feel a need to control every detail, questioning design choices, demanding frequent updates, and overriding your expertise. This can stifle innovation, slow down progress, and demoralize the team.
Why It’s Happening (and What They’re Really Saying)
Beyond simple control, consider these underlying motivations:
-
Fear of Failure: They’re worried about the project failing and the repercussions for them.
-
Lack of Trust: They may not fully trust your expertise or the team’s capabilities.
-
Perceived Lack of Visibility: They feel they aren’t getting enough information or insight into the project’s progress.
-
Past Experiences: Previous project failures might have instilled a need for tighter control.
-
Misunderstanding of Roles: They may not understand the Cloud Solutions Architect’s role and responsibilities.
The Approach: Assertive Communication & Stakeholder Management
The key is to address the underlying concerns while firmly establishing boundaries. This isn’t about confrontation; it’s about collaborative problem-solving. Here’s a breakdown of strategies:
-
Empathy & Active Listening: Begin by understanding their perspective. Ask open-ended questions like, “What are your biggest concerns about this project?” and actively listen to their responses. Reflect back what you hear to ensure understanding.
-
Education & Transparency: Explain technical concepts in non-technical terms. Use analogies and visualizations. Provide regular, concise updates that focus on progress, risks, and mitigation strategies.
-
Define Roles & Responsibilities: Clearly outline your role as the technical expert and their role as a decision-maker focused on business outcomes. Document this agreement.
-
Establish Decision-Making Processes: Define how decisions will be made, including when your input is required and when they have final authority.
-
Proactive Communication: Anticipate their questions and concerns and address them proactively.
-
Focus on Business Value: Frame your technical decisions in terms of their impact on business goals – cost savings, improved performance, increased security, etc.
High-Pressure Negotiation Script (Meeting Scenario)
Setting: Scheduled one-on-one meeting with the stakeholder.
You: “Thank you for taking the time to meet with me. I appreciate your commitment to this project’s success. I’ve noticed we have slightly different approaches to how we’re managing certain aspects, and I wanted to discuss how we can optimize our collaboration to ensure we deliver the best possible outcome.”
Stakeholder: (Likely response: “I just want to make sure everything goes smoothly.”)
You: “I understand completely. My goal is the same. To ensure things go smoothly, I believe it’s important to clarify our roles and how we make decisions. As the Cloud Solutions Architect, my responsibility is to design and implement the technical solution, leveraging my expertise to ensure it’s scalable, secure, and cost-effective. Your role, as I understand it, is to focus on the overall business objectives and ensure the solution aligns with those goals. Do you feel that accurately reflects your perspective?”
Stakeholder: (Possible response: “Well, yes, but I need to be kept in the loop…”)
You: “Absolutely. I’m committed to keeping you informed. Currently, I provide [mention current update frequency and method – e.g., weekly status reports, bi-weekly demos]. However, I’ve found that frequent, detailed questions on specific technical implementations can sometimes disrupt the workflow and slow down progress. Could we explore a slightly adjusted cadence, perhaps focusing on key milestones and high-level design reviews, while I handle the day-to-day technical execution?”
Stakeholder: (Possible response: “I’m worried about making mistakes.”)
You: “That’s a valid concern. Mistakes can happen, but my role is to identify and mitigate those risks. I’ll proactively flag potential issues and present solutions. By trusting my expertise in this area, we can minimize those risks and ensure a robust solution. Would you be open to me presenting a risk mitigation plan for your review?”
Stakeholder: (Possible response: “I suppose so, but I still want to be involved.”)
You: “Of course. I value your input. Let’s agree that I’ll present key design decisions and potential risks for your review and approval, and then I’ll proceed with the implementation. This allows you to maintain oversight while allowing me to focus on the technical execution. Does that sound like a workable compromise?”
End with a Summary: “So, to recap, we’ve agreed on [summarize agreed-upon roles, communication frequency, and decision-making process]. I’m confident that this approach will allow us to work together effectively and deliver a successful project.”
Technical Vocabulary
-
Scalability: The ability of a system to handle increased workload.
-
High Availability (HA): Ensuring continuous operation of a system, minimizing downtime.
-
Infrastructure as Code (IaC): Managing and provisioning infrastructure through code.
-
Microservices: An architectural style that structures an application as a collection of loosely coupled services.
-
Serverless Computing: A cloud computing execution model where the cloud provider dynamically manages the allocation of machine resources.
-
Cloud Native: Technologies that leverage cloud computing to their fullest.
-
Latency: Delay between a request and a response.
-
Cost Optimization: Reducing cloud spending without impacting performance.
-
Disaster Recovery (DR): Processes and procedures to recover from a disruptive event.
-
API Gateway: A point of entry for all API requests, managing authentication, authorization, and routing.
Cultural & Executive Nuance
-
Respect Hierarchy: Acknowledge their position and authority, even if you disagree. Frame your suggestions as improvements to the process, not criticisms of their management style.
-
Focus on Business Outcomes: Always tie your technical explanations and recommendations back to business value. Use metrics and data to support your arguments.
-
Be Prepared: Anticipate their questions and have data and explanations ready.
-
Document Everything: Keep a record of decisions, agreements, and communication.
-
Seek Support: If the situation doesn’t improve, escalate to your manager or a trusted mentor for guidance.
-
Maintain Professionalism: Even if frustrated, remain calm, respectful, and solution-oriented. Avoid defensiveness or accusatory language.
